This is kind of confusing, but I chatted with Pamela today about the "spin off series" because a Goodreads librarian had listed Skin Deep as book #1 in the I-Team After Hours series, and Pamela had me move it back to the original I-Team series as book #5.5.
According to Pamela, the I-Team After Hours books aren't actually another series at all. The books labeled After Hours will all be novellas about secondary characters or brief visits with our favorite heroes (and heroines) from the full length books. So yeah, it's not really a spin-off or another series. More like a clarification/classification.
I hope I explained it clearly.
